N. Sarath Krishna is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Molecular Biology and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. According to data from OpenAlex, N. Sarath Krishna has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 685 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 4 papers in Molecular Biology and 3 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. Recurrent topics in N. Sarath Krishna’s work include Prostate Cancer Treatment and Research (5 papers), Hormonal and reproductive studies (3 papers) and Sexual Differentiation and Disorders (2 papers). N. Sarath Krishna is often cited by papers focused on Prostate Cancer Treatment and Research (5 papers), Hormonal and reproductive studies (3 papers) and Sexual Differentiation and Disorders (2 papers). N. Sarath Krishna coll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om. N. Sarath Krishna's co-authors include Joanne Edwards, John M.S. Bartlett, Ken Grigor, Caroline Witton, R Mukherjee, Anita Chugh, Atul Tiwari, M.A. Underwood, A.D. Watters and Mark A. Underwood and has published in prestigious journals such as British Journal of Cancer, The Journal of Pathology and BJU International.
